as posted by the channelWith a better understanding of population ecology, we are ready to zoom out and look at community ecology, which involves interactions between species, as well as landscape ecology, which will broaden our understanding of ecosystems. How are communities structured? What are ecological webs? What is resource partitioning? Or succession? What about the urban-rural gradient? So much to talk about!
